Understanding the IELTS Exam

Before diving into the options, it's crucial to understand what the IELTS exam involves. IELTS is jointly handled by the British Council, IDP: IELTS Australia, and Cambridge Assessment English. The test is readily available in 2 formats: Academic and General Training. The Academic format appropriates for individuals who wish to study at a greater education organization or join a professional organization in an English-speaking nation, while the General Training format is designed for those who are planning to migrate to an English-speaking country or look for employment there.

The IELTS exam is divided into four areas:

  1. Listening: Candidates listen to 4 tape-recorded texts and answer concerns based upon what they hear.
  2. Checking out: This area consists of 3 passages and a range of question types created to test reading understanding.
  3. Composing: Candidates are needed to write 2 essays, among which is generally an action to a graph, chart, or table, and the other is a response to an argument or issue.
  4. Speaking: This is an in person interview with an IELTS inspector, which examines the prospect's ability to interact successfully in English.

Legitimate Alternatives to the IELTS Exam

While it is not possible to get a genuine IELTS certificate without taking the exam, there are numerous genuine alternatives that can serve a comparable function, depending on your specific requirements and circumstances.

  1. Other English Language Proficiency Tests

    • TOEFL (Test of English as a Foreign Language): Widely accepted by universities and organizations, TOEFL is another standardized test that evaluates English proficiency. The test is divided into four sections: Reading, Listening, Speaking, and Writing.
    • PTE (Pearson Test of English): PTE is a computer-based test that assesses English language abilities. It is recognized by thousands of institutions around the world and is divided into three primary parts: Speaking and Writing, Listening, and Reading.
    • Cambridge English Exams: These include the Cambridge English: Advanced (CAE) and Cambridge English: Proficiency (CPE) examinations, which are highly regarded and accepted by numerous institutions.
  2. English Language Courses and Certifications

    • University-Specific English Language Courses: Many universities provide their own English language courses and proficiency tests. Finishing these courses and passing the internal tests can in some cases be accepted in place of IELTS.
    • EFL (English as a Foreign Language) Certifications: EFL courses and accreditations, such as those used by the British Council or other reputable companies, can supply a recognized alternative to IELTS for specific functions.
  3. Exemptions and Waivers

    • Native English Speakers: Individuals who are native English speakers or have actually completed a substantial part of their education in an English-speaking nation may be exempt from taking IELTS.
    • Work Experience: Some organizations might accept pertinent work experience in an English-speaking environment as a substitute for an IELTS certificate.
    • Expert Qualifications: Certain expert qualifications, such as those from the UK's General Medical Council (GMC) or the Law Society, may be recognized in location of ielts test certificate.
  4. Online English Proficiency Tests

    • Duolingo English Test: This is a more economical and accessible online test that can be finished in about an hour. It is accepted by a growing number of institutions, especially in the United States.
    • LanguageCert International English Language Testing System ESOL: This is another online test that evaluates English language proficiency and is acknowledged by various companies.
